One such story says that the kakori kebab was created by the nawab of kakori, syed mohammad haider kazmi, who, stung by the remark of a british officer about the coarse texture of the kebabs served at dinner, ordered his rakabdars gourmet cooks to evolve a more refined seekh kebab. The new version of the seekh kebab met with great applause and since then the kakori became famous by word of mouth and even today, though cooked elsewhere, are known as kakori kebabs.
